			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Columbus Blue Jackets were defeated on Thursday night 4-1 by the Los Angeles Kings. In front of the home crowd at Nationwide Arena, the Blue Jackets were shut-out through the first two periods. The Kings goaltender Jonathan Quick saved 29 of 30 shots for his 28th win of the season.</p>
<p>The Kings scored their first goal at the 11:05 mark when Matt Greene scored just his second goal of the season, assisted by Alexander Frolov. That goal was the lone goal for the first period. In the second period, the Kings once again scored the lone goal as Anze Kopitar notched his 21st goal of the season. Ryan Smyth and Wayne Simmonds got together on the assist.</p>
<p>In the third period, Ryan Smyth and Anze Kopitar added his second goal of the game to give Los Angeles a 4-0 lead. Columbus scored their lone goal of the night with 9:22 to go. Antoine Vermette scored his 17th goal of the season to put the Blue Jackets on the score board. The Blue Jackets out shot the Kings 30-18, including 12-3 in the final period.</p>
<p>The win for the Kings moved them to 31-19-3 overall, while Columbus fell to 21-26-9. The Blue Jackets will now host the St. Louis Blues on Saturday. The game will feature the 13th and 14th team in the Western Conference. St. Louis leads the Blue Jackets by 3 points for fourth place in the Central Division. St. Louis is 9-14-4 at home, and the Blue Jackets are 9-17-4 on the road.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://firethecannon.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/02/Avalanche+Logos.gif"><img alt="" src="http://firethecannon.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/02/Avalanche+Logos1.gif" border="0" /></a> <span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">Colorado comes to town tonight for the final meeting of the season between the two squads, looking to avoid an uncharacteristic season sweep at the hands of the CBJ. Columbus prevailed 4 &#8211; 2 and 6 &#8211; 1 in Denver, and squeaked out a 4 &#8211; 3 win at home in the most recent contest at Nationwide.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">The Avs will not be traveling with Adam Foote, still suffering from his torn tricep injury, thereby successfully ducking the various &#8220;Burn Foote In Effigy&#8221; events planned for his return. The EBay market for Foote bobbleheads to commit atrocities against has dropped dramatically in recent days.  </span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">The Avs come into the game with 51 points, and a 3 &#8211; 7 record over their past 10 games.  That span includes an 8 game homes stand, during which they went 3 -5.  They are 2 &#8211; 1 in their last 3, including consecutive wins over Calgary and Dallas at home, followed by a 4 &#8211; 1 road loss at St. Louis.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">The Avs rank 20th in Goals Scored, 22nd in Goals Against, 20th on the Power Play and 25th on the PK.  Although the Jackets are still 30th on the PP, they have been playing at just about a 17% clip since December.  They remain 13th in goals agains, 21st in Goals Scored and 19th on the PK.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">Despite Colorado falling on hard times, due largely to injury and age, they are not to be taken lightly.  Ryan Smyth is always a Jacket killker, and leads the Avs with 16-26-42.  Hejduk has been playing well of late, and is close behind at 20-20-40.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">The keys for us are as follows:</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;"><strong><em>Size Matters &#8212; </em></strong>We have a considerable size advantage over this club, which we have used to our advantage this year, and need to continue.  Outman them in front of the net, out muscle them for the puck.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;"><strong><em>Picket Fence &#8212; </em></strong>Watching that line of bodies in the neutral zone against San Jose was a joy.  We can be so disruptive and difficult to play when we do that, check hard and forecheck.  Let&#8217;s see more of that tonight.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:verdana;font-size:85%;"><strong><em>Crispness &#8212; </em></strong>Good passing, heads up, support in our own zone, aggressiveness on offense &#8212; play with purpose.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;"><strong><em>No Letdowns &#8212; </em></strong>We need another full 60 minute effort, supporting our young netminder, getting in the habit of getting an opponent down, then finishing them off.  I&#8217;d like this game to be in the Jacket&#8217;s pocket by the end of the 2nd, and have us put our foot on the gas more in the 3rd, just so they can get a feeling for it.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-family:Verdana;font-size:85%;">Every two points means a lot at this point of the season, but a sweep of the Avs would be extra sweet.  Go Jackets!!</span></p>
